sqlserver内存数据库

什么是.sqlserver内存数据库
SQL Server内存数据库是一种高性能数据存储解决方案,它将数据完全存储在内存中,而不是在磁盘上。这使得内存数据库能够无缝地处理大量的事务和查询请求,并提供超快的响应时间。SQL Server的内存数据库还提供了高度的可伸缩性,使得它成为高度动态的应用程序所必需的存储引擎。
SQLserver内存数据库的特点
SQL Server内存数据库具有以下突出特点:1.高性能:内存数据库使用高速的内存存储引擎,以无缝的方式处理大量的查询请求,提供超快的响应时间。2.可扩展性:内存数据库是高度可扩展的,它可以随着应用程序的需要进行动态扩展,以确保一直具有卓越的性能和可用性。3.轻量级:SQL Server内存数据库是一种轻量级的解决方案,它在操作上比传统的关系数据库更为简单,易于使用。4.易于管理:内存数据库几乎不需要维护,可以简化管理任务,并有助于减少IT部门的工作量。
SQLserver内存数据库的优缺点
SQL Server的内存数据库有以下优点和缺点:优点:1.快速:由于数据存储在内存中,内存数据库能够提供非常快速的响应时间。2.高可用性:内存数据库的高可用性意味着它可以轻松地处理各种应用程序的需求。缺点:1.成本高:内存数据库要求大量的内存,这可能会导致高昂的成本。2.数据持久性:内存数据库不是永久性存储,如果系统崩溃,数据可能会丢失。
SQLserver内存数据库的应用场景
SQL Server内存数据库适用于以下场景:1.高负载事务:内存数据库适用于需要高速处理大量事务的环境,如金融、电子商务和在线游戏。2.实时数据分析:内存数据库适用于需要实时数据分析的业务领域,如通信和媒体等。3.数据缓存:内存数据库可以作为高效的缓存系统,降低对后端存储的访问需求量,以提高应用程序的性能。4.无服务器计算:内存数据库可以作为无服务器计算平台的后端存储引擎,使得在 AWS Lambda 和 Azure Functions 上部署应用程序更容易。
如何使用SQLserver内存数据库
使用SQL Server的内存数据库相对简单,以下是几个简单的步骤:1.创建内存数据库表。2.定义表上的索引。3.加载数据并运行查询。在SQL Server中创建内存数据库表时,必须指定一个用于上传数据的表变量或表类型。您还需要创建索引以优化查询性能。要加载数据,可以使用标准T-SQL INSERT语句。在内存数据库中运行查询时,没有必要使用显式事务,并且您可以使用多个查询窗口以并行方式执行查询。

